Lists the parameters in your Amazon Web Services account or the parameters shared with you when you enable the Shared option.
Request results are returned on a best-effort basis. If you specify MaxResults
in the request, the response includes information up to the limit specified. The number
of items returned, however, can be between zero and the value of MaxResults
.
If the service reaches an internal limit while processing the results, it stops the
operation and returns the matching values up to that point and a NextToken
.
You can specify the NextToken
in a subsequent call to get the next set of results.
If you change the KMS key alias for the KMS key used to encrypt a parameter, then
you must also update the key alias the parameter uses to reference KMS. Otherwise,
DescribeParameters
retrieves whatever the original key alias was referencing.
This is an asynchronous operation using the standard naming convention for .NET 4.5 or higher. For .NET 3.5 the operation is implemented as a pair of methods using the standard naming convention of BeginDescribeParameters and EndDescribeParameters.

Exception | Condition |
---|---|
InternalServerErrorException | An error occurred on the server side. |
InvalidFilterKeyException | The specified key isn't valid. |
InvalidFilterOptionException | The specified filter option isn't valid. Valid options are Equals and BeginsWith. For Path filter, valid options are Recursive and OneLevel. |
InvalidFilterValueException | The filter value isn't valid. Verify the value and try again. |
InvalidNextTokenException | The specified token isn't valid. |
